At&t Pure (Diamond2) live and in the flesh

At&t Pure (Diamond2) live and in the flesh

That Asurion updated claim form that surfaced about an hour ago has just become a confirmed piece of HTC Pure history.  Over on Tilt Mobility the first-ever unboxing photos of the At&t Pure were just posted, confirming the device and silencing the doubters.  So we know the device is legit and that At&t will be the first U.S. carrier to launch the Diamond2, but what about a release date and pricing on a 2-year service agreement?  We are still in the dark on those two questions, but rumors hint towards an Oct 6 release date to coincide with the Windows Mobile 6.5 worldwide launch day.
